Abstract

The invention discloses a self-adaptive cruise control method and device and an automatic driving vehicle. The self-adaptive cruise control method comprises the steps that current video information infront of a vehicle is collected; the transverse position of a front vehicle and a first relative speed relative to the vehicle are obtained according to the current video information; and a current position of the front vehicle is obtained according to the transverse position, the first relative speed, a longitudinal position obtained through a radar and a second relative speed relative to the vehicle, and the front vehicle is used as a following target vehicle of a self-adaptive cruise mode when the current vehicle speed of the current position and the front vehicle meets a preset followingcondition. According to the self-adaptive cruise control method, the transverse distance and transverse speed of the target vehicle are obtained according to the video information, so that the relative position of a front target and the vehicle advancing track is judged, rapid reaction is given to target vehicle cut-in/cut-out, the following stability of a self-adaptive cruise control system is improved, the reliability and safety of self-adaptive cruise are effectively ensured, and user experience is improved.

technical field [0001] The invention relates to the technical field of automobiles, in particular to an adaptive cruise control method and device and an automatic driving vehicle. Background technique [0002] Related technologies, since the radar can detect the vehicles in front in real time, it is not affected by weather and light, and there are no problems such as human driver fatigue driving, drunk driving, emotional driving, etc., so the adaptive cruise system can greatly improve driving safety and driving safety. comfort. [0003] Specifically, an adaptive cruise system of an autonomous vehicle generally uses a millimeter-wave radar as a sensor for detecting targets.
